摘要

The article examines the importance of integrating spatial planning and natural disaster management to ensure sustainable development. Contemporary challenges such as climate change, urbanization, and environmental degradation demand new approaches to territorial planning. The concept of synergy between spatial planning and natural disaster risk reduction measures is proposed to more effectively protect populations and infrastructure from natural catastrophes. The research is based on an analysis of best practices in risk management and urban planning, as well as successful integration examples from various countries. Special attention is given to Ukrainian experience in developing and implementing comprehensive community plans, considering local conditions and needs. Key challenges, strategies, and approaches to achieving sustainable development through enhanced spatial planning are highlighted. It is noted that Ukraine has come a long way in creating the necessary prerequisites for introducing a new spatial planning system, thanks to successful local self-government and territorial reform, legislative improvements, the creation of amalgamated territorial communities, and active collaboration with international organizations. This has enabled the development and implementation of comprehensive territorial development plans. The article’s authors discuss the procedure of Strategic Environmental Assessment of urban documentation, which includes a comprehensive development plan of the territorial community, a master plan of the settlement, and detailed area plans, ensuring coordinated use of natural resource potential, including measures to prevent conflicts and improve environmental quality, particularly the preservation of cultural heritage and ensuring sustainable community development. The study addresses legal and regulatory issues related to spatial planning in the context of natural risks, highlighting key challenges, strategies, and approaches to achieving sustainable development through enhanced spatial planning. In conclusion, it emphasizes that integrating spatial planning with disaster risk management is a key element of sustainable development, contributing to community resilience and population safety.
